Celebrate the warmth, color, and joy of summer through rhythm, repetition, and inclusive design.

Summer Is... invites children to experience the bright, busy world of summer-sunshine and swimsuits, ice cream and laughter, days that stretch long into evening. With rhythmic, engaging text and high-contrast visuals, this book supports early learning, visual attention, and joyful participation for all children, including those with Cortical Visual Impairment (CVI) and sensory differences.

Created by educator Amy Shepherd, M.Ed., this title is part of the Seasons Are... Series, a collection of CVI-informed books designed to make the beauty of each season accessible, engaging, and inclusive.

Key Features:

CVI-informed design: Simplified layouts, bold imagery, and high contrast support visual access. Predictable rhythm and repetition foster comprehension and memory. Inclusive storytelling encourages concept development and participation. Perfect for summer units, home reading, or therapy sessions.

Ideal For:

Children with Cortical Visual Impairment (CVI) or low vision Preschool through early elementary learners Speech, occupational, and vision therapists Inclusive classrooms and early literacy programs
